Sun issues correction, apology on Rodimer editorial

Wed, Sep 2, 2020 (11:17 a.m.)

A Sun editorial published Aug. 24 contained a significant factual error about Nevada congressional candidate Dan Rodimer. The editorial stated that Rodimer was a “convicted criminal” with a battery conviction on his record stemming from a 2010 incident in Florida, but that was incorrect.

Instead, Rodimer entered a deferred prosecution agreement. He admitted to committing the offense of battery in that agreement, but did not plead guilty to the charge. Rodimer completed a six-week anger management course, and prosecutors agreed not to continue the case against him.

The Sun regrets the error and apologizes to Rodimer and his family for it. Rodimer is a Republican attempting to unseat incumbent Susie Lee in Nevada’s 3rd Congressional District.
